Using Coconut Avocado Hair Mask as a Leave-In

Massaging our Coconut Avocado Hair Mask into my locs weekly is a staple after washing with the Mint & Tea Tree Shampoo Bar.  
Nothing complicated as I prefer simplicity.  The Coconut Avocado Hair Mask is multi-use and can be used as a pre-poo, conditioner, or leave-in. Watch the video below and see how I use this ultra-light mask as a leave-in. 
This is the ultimate food for your hair made with organic coconut oil and avocado oil infused with potent rosemary, nettle and horsetail herbs. These ingredients work together to strengthen and revitalize your hair leaving it with a healthy shine.

First New Arrival of the New Year!

I have been sick all year (literally) and I'm playing catch up behind the scenes.  I have several new products that I plan to introduce before the spring and here's the first.....Eva Jenae Naturals Sisal Soap Pouch
This Sisal Soap Pouch is a lifesaver for your handmade soaps and shampoo bars! Our bars naturally contain a high amount of glycerin which attracts moisture. While this is great for your skin, it’s not so great for the life of your soap because it will break down rapidly if left in moisture.  Sisal is a natural fiber so this pouch doubles as an exfoliator while extending the life your soap. Use it to hang your soap between uses and allow to dry.
